Accueil | . | Publications | . | Présentations | . | Logiciels | . | Sujets de stages | . | Cours | . | Awards |
Je m'intéresse à la programmation des systèmes temps-réel embarqués. En particulier, j'aime beaucoup les langages synchrones comme Esterel, Lustre et Signal. Récemment, cela m'a amené à considérer les systèmes robotiques embarqués, qui sont un cas particulier des systèmes temps-réel embarqués. En ce moment, je suis impliqué dans plusieurs projets de recherche, parmis lesquels il y a :
Un projet sur la tolérance aux fautes, avec des développements récents sur des heuristiques bi-critères (fiabilité et chemin critique) et sur la construction automatique de systèmes tolérants aux fautes grâce à des techniques de synthèse de contrôleurs discrets.
Une ACI sur la programmation par composants.
Un projet de preuve de bisimulation par systèmes d'inférence.
Enfin, j'ai co-encadré plusieurs étudiants en thèse : Laure France sur la simulation graphique de robots bipèdes, Christophe Le Gal sur la génération de plans et la synthèse de programmes, Hamoudi Kalla sur la tolérance aux fautes dans les systèmes réactifs, répartis et embarqués (en cours), et Gwenaël Delaval sur l'ordre supérieur dynamique en programmation synchrone (en cours). J'ai encadré également plusieurs postdocs : Mihaela Sighireanu et Catalin Dima sur la tolérance aux fautes pour les systèmes répartis, Emil Dumitrescu sur la synthèse de contrôleurs tolérants aux fautes, ainsi que Tolga Ayav sur la programmation par aspects pour systèmes tolérants aux fautes (en cours).